Former Sacramento Kings forward Jason Thompson joined Carmichael Dave and Jason Ross to talk about experiencing Game 1 between the Sacramento Kings and Golden State Warriors in person.

Thompson holds the record for the most games played as a King in the Sacramento era with 541. Unfortunately, those years came during the team’s playoff drought.

“So just thinking like, how it was and to where it is now man, shows you why the team should always have been in the city and the fans deserve it,” Thompson said on the show. “You guys deserve it through thick and thin man. I think no one could even hear themselves think the other day, and it was love.”
